How Heavy Can A Check In Bag Be. We calculate the size limits of your bag by adding the total outside dimensions of each bag, length + width + height. We don't accept checked bags over 100 lbs / 45 kgs on american airlines operated flights. A standard checked bag measuring 62” must be within 50 lbs (23 kg) for economy passengers and within 70 lbs (32 kg) for first and business class passengers. There is no standard worldwide weight limit for a checked bag or for international checked bag size. Airlines around the world tend to have a similar weight. This usually includes handles and wheels. Max dimensions (length + width + height) of a standard checked baggage is 62 inches (158 cm). First class and business class also have higher american airlines checked bag weight allowances, and can check bags up to 70 lbs before overweight charges kick in.
